Proposal
Replacement of existing windows with new PVCu to original design with Astragal glazing bars and new front door and rear door. (Amended Description)
As published by the council, reference 24/1721/HD

About householder applications
Householder applications cover work to an existing house and its garden, such as extensions, lofts and outbuildings, and cannot create a separate dwelling or change what the building is used for. More in our guide to planning application types.
